Troubleshooting
Common TouchBistro hardware problems.
Quick checks for the most frequent printer, drawer, and iPad connectivity issues.
| Issue | What to Check |
|---|---|
| Receipt printer not printing | Verify printer IP address, check Ethernet connectivity, confirm printer assignment inside TouchBistro, restart printer and iPad. |
| Kitchen printer missing tickets | Verify kitchen routing configuration, check network connectivity, confirm printer online status and station assignment. |
| Cash drawer will not open | Check RJ12 cable connection, verify compatible receipt printer, confirm drawer kick and voltage compatibility. |
| iPad disconnects from printers | Verify wireless network stability, separate POS traffic from guest Wi-Fi, restart wireless equipment, check printer IP assignments. |
Frequently Asked Questions
TouchBistro hardware questions, answered.
Compatibility depends on your POS software, operating system, connection type, drivers, accessories, and configuration — confirm before ordering.
What hardware works with TouchBistro?
Receipt printers, kitchen printers, cash drawers, barcode scanners, iPads, and networking hardware — depending on the restaurant workflow and connection type.
Does TouchBistro use kitchen printers?
Yes. Many restaurants deploy Ethernet-connected impact kitchen printers for prep stations, bars, and kitchen ticket routing.
Can TouchBistro use Ethernet printers?
Yes — Ethernet printers are commonly recommended because they provide more reliable restaurant printer communication and kitchen ticket routing.
Can TouchBistro use Bluetooth printers?
TouchBistro supports some Bluetooth printers, but Ethernet is commonly preferred for restaurant reliability and multi-station workflows.
Does TouchBistro work with iPads?
Yes. TouchBistro is designed around Apple iPad hardware and supports most modern iPad models.
What are the best receipt printers for TouchBistro?
Star Micronics and Epson printers are among the most commonly used printer brands in TouchBistro restaurant environments.
